  15. Gue

    Guest Guest

    Good point mate....

    They would basically own the players and the staff.

    They would NOT own any land or the ground... When PC and BMBC took over they split the club in two...

    The football club (playing staff etc) and then the land/ground etc...

    There is only one share in Barnsley FC, the football club.

    <span class="ps_0_15"><span class="ft_0_2">That was transferred from P Riddy to Shep who is the current owner of the club as Leeds Tyke says..</span></span><span class="ps_0_15"><span class="ft_0_2"></span></span></p>

    <span class="ps_0_15"><span class="ft_0_2">Barnsley</span></span> <span class="ps_0_16"><span class="ft_0_0">Barnsley Football Club 2002 Limited. Incorporated October 2002 with 1 share</span></span> <span class="ps_0_17"><span class="ft_0_0">(Cobbetts (Nominees) Limited). Change of ownership reported June 2003.</span></span> </p>
